The Real Healthcare Emergency: Why Interoperability is the Unsolved Foundation of Digital Health

Clinical information isn’t moving where it needs to go. Despite decades of investment in health IT, the industry is still grappling with basic data exchange. As recently as 2023, 47.4% of small hospitals and 42.8% of rural hospitals still relied on mail or fax as their primary method of exchanging patient information.
